  • Leas is good option 450 a week for used truck and for new 500 dollars a week .But this is not bad wat is bad is 0.14 for ever mile you drive that's what is killing drivers.So 450 a week truck payment plus you drive lets say average 2500 a week thats aditional another 350- so for solo driver with older truck you looking at minim 800 dollars a week minim- plus permits and registration and insurence which is anotehr 250 a week.So solo driver has to pay $1050 just for a truck minimum .Thanks

  • Don't take any one's word, get the lease contract before you start with the company. Talk to truck driver's who like the company and ask why? Try to find the why and not just people who had a bad time with the company. All companies have some bull.Cr England could not stay in business without having some driver's who are doing well. Training is usually what lease purchase programs require to make it.
